Common TH.exe Errors on Windows
Encountering errors associated with TH.exe can be frustrating. These errors may vary in nature and can surface due to different reasons, such as software conflicts, outdated drivers, or even malware infections. Below, we've outlined the most commonly reported errors linked to TH.exe, to aid in understanding and potentially resolving the issues at hand.
- Runtime Errors: This warning is displayed when there's an issue with a program while it's being executed. This might be caused by software glitches, uncontrolled memory consumption, or conflicting actions with other active software.
- TH.exe File Not Executing: Sometimes, despite double-clicking an .exe file, the program might not start. This could be due to incorrect file permissions, system issues, or conflicting software.
- TH.exe - System Error: This alert appears when the execution of TH.exe causes a system issue. Possible causes might include clashes with other software, damaged system files, or insufficient system resources.
- Error 0xc0000005: This error message is shown when there is an access violation issue, commonly due to memory problems, malware infection, or outdated drivers.
- Error 0xc0000142: This error message appears when an application wasn't able to start correctly, often due to issues in the software itself, corrupted files, or problems with Windows registry.

Run a System File Checker (SFC) to Fix the TH.exe Error
In this guide, we will attempt to fix the TH.exe error by scanning Windows system files.
-
Press the Windows key.
-
Type
Command Promptin the search bar. -
Right-click on Command Prompt and select Run as administrator.
-
In the Command Prompt window, type
sfc /scannowand press Enter. -
Allow the System File Checker to scan your system for errors.
Run the Windows Check Disk Utility
How to use the Windows Check Disk Utility. Scans your disk for TH.exe errors and automatically fix them.
-
Press the Windows key.
-
Type
Command Promptin the search bar and press Enter. -
Right-click on Command Prompt and select Run as administrator.
-
In the Command Prompt window, type
chkdsk /fand press Enter. -
If the system reports that it cannot run the check because the disk is in use, type
Yand press Enter to schedule the check for the next system restart.
-
If you had to schedule the check, restart your computer for the check to be performed.
